And it’s gone! Iconic Lincoln bridge demolished on Brayford Wharf

An iconic former service bridge on Brayford Wharf East has now been fully demolished. Final work is now taking place to tidy up the area following the demolition of the bridge. The bridge was pulled down by CLS Demolition on behalf of the Estates and Campus Services team at the University of Lincoln.

The university explained when they applied for permission to demolish the bridge that, due to the condition of the bridge, it was “structurally unsound and beyond economic repair.”
